Abstract: The mechanism of constraint in NIST standard of role-based access control (RBAC) is analyzed. To resolve the problem of shortages of constraints in the authorization process and accessing objects process, a novel RBAC model with enhanced constraints is proposed by extending the constraints and mapping true-life operation that has constrainted capability into RBAC model. The formalization definitions of the new model are presented and its security analyzed.
